Understanding Personal Injury Law
What is Personal Injury?
Personal injury refers to physical or emotional harm caused by another person's negligence or wrongdoing. This can encompass a wide range of incidents, from car accidents and motorcycle collisions to slip-and-fall injuries and medical malpractice. Understanding the definition of personal injury is crucial in determining your eligibility for compensation. Types of personal injury cases vary greatly, impacting the legal strategy needed to secure a favorable outcome. Establishing negligence is a key element in personal injury cases. The Process of Filing a Personal Injury Claim
Steps to Take After an Accident
Following an accident, taking swift action is critical. Seek immediate medical attention for your injuries, even if they seem minor. Gather evidence at the scene, including photos, videos, and contact information of witnesses. File a police report to document the incident and provide an official record. These actions are crucial steps in building a strong personal injury claim. Failing to take these steps could negatively impact the outcome of your case. Types of Compensation Available
Understanding Damages
Personal injury claims seek compensation for various damages. Medical expenses cover the cost of treatment, rehabilitation, and future medical care. Lost wages account for income lost due to injury. Pain and suffering compensate for physical and emotional distress. Additional damages may include property damage, loss of consortium, and other related expenses. The amount of compensation available depends on the specifics of your case. It's essential to have a thorough understanding of the types of damages that may be recovered.
Factors Affecting Your Compensation Amount
Several factors influence the amount of compensation you can receive. The severity of your injuries is paramount, as more severe injuries justify higher compensation. Fault determination plays a crucial role, with compensation often reduced if you share responsibility for the accident. Insurance policy limits dictate the maximum amount an insurance company will pay. Expert testimony, such as from medical professionals, can greatly impact the value of your claim. Documentation is key in determining what compensations you are entitled to.

Frequently Asked Questions
- What should I do immediately after an accident? Seek medical attention, gather evidence, and contact the authorities. How long does it typically take to resolve a personal injury claim? Timelines vary, but cases can take several months or even years. Will my case go to trial, or will it be settled out of court? Most cases settle out of court, but some proceed to trial. What happens if I was partially at fault for the accident? Your compensation may be reduced based on your degree of fault.
